Wrong. If it would be a 64-bit DLL in System32 of a x86_64 system then there would be no problem. However a 64-bit DLL in the SysWOW64 directory (thus the 32-bit System32 directory) *is* a problem. Same for a 32-bit DLL in the System32 directory of a x86_64 system.
